Job Description
St Cuthbert’s looks to appoint our new Deputy Principal and Head of Senior School who will lead our exceptional Senior School staff, students and families, and have responsibility for pastoral, academic, cocurricular and service learning delivery. They will also deputise for the Principal, as required.
With over 100 years of experience in educating young women, St Cuthbert’s continues to embrace its founding heritage and traditions while ensuring that we impart skills that young women will need for tomorrow and well into the future. Our girls achieve exceptional academic outcomes. Equally important is that they thrive, find their voice and fulfil their potential: we believe that girls who are happy and well learn best. Innovative curriculum and excellent teaching complement outstanding care and rich cocurricular programs, enabling each girl to find her passions and develop her confidence. Our motto, ‘By Love Serve’ encapsulates the values that inspire our community. We want our staff, as well as our girls, to share in world class learning: we will continue to enhance our programmes and approaches to deliver on that.
Our new Deputy Principal and Head of Senior School will work with the Principal and the senior leadership team in rolling out our latest strategy across the College. There will be significant opportunities for professional growth, including exposure to governance. Our Deputy Principal and Head of Senior School will be a visible and capable leader who is committed to educational excellence. They will be experienced in the smooth running of a senior school and have a record of developing and implementing integrated programmes that achieve outstanding learning outcomes.
